WebNov 15, 2013 · If you had to you could run regular for weeks and not hurt the engine. The engine has knock sensors which will detect pre-ignition or detonation and modify the engine spark timing to protect the engine. However, it will … readon software配置 https://billymacgill.com

WebNov 10, 2024 · Most BMWs can run on regular gas so you aren’t at any risk of causing damage to your brother’s car. When you put regular gas in a BMW as opposed to premium, the car will recognize this and may run with a little less power and less timing but all components will work properly.
